How were relations with Mexico strained?

US-Mexico relations have had many highs and lows. Some examples of the later include: The US annexation of Texas, which ultimately led to the Mexican-American War (1846 - 1848). The US occupation of Veracruz (1914).


What were the relations between Mexico and the republic of Texas?

Enmity. Texas was viewed as a rebel territory, to be later re-acquired by peaceful means, but by force if necessary.
